National City, California is a city that has been affected by many social issues for years. Addiction is one of them. This is a problem that has been tackled by the community over time via various means. In this city, the process of addiction treatment has been well thought of, with significant investment in recovery tools, programs, and treatments.One of the main approaches used when it comes to addiction treatment in National City is inpatient treatment. This involves putting the patient in a monitored and controlled environment where they are helped to overcome their addiction. Inpatient treatment allows for around the clock monitoring, counseling, and medical attention. It is crucial to provide patients with all the support and care they need, to mitigate the possibilities of relapse. This approach is often used when the patient’s addiction is severe, and they require intensive care. Outpatient treatment is another approach that is common in National City. This approach is often recommended for people who have work, school, or other commitments that they cannot disengage from. Outpatient treatment entails the same process as inpatient treatment, but the patient is allowed to go home after every session. There is no constant monitoring and medical attention, but keeping up with the schedule is key for a successful recovery.Addiction treatment centers in National City offer a variety of programs tailored to the individual needs of patients. These programs include group therapy sessions, individual sessions, and family support sessions. Group therapy sessions allow patients to interact with others who are going through similar experiences, while individual sessions enable the therapist to address the patient’s specific issues in a more personal way. Family support sessions encompass educating the patient’s family on how to offer emotional support to the patient during the recovery process. The use of medications such as suboxone, methadone, buprenorphine, and naltrexone is also common in addiction treatment centers in National City. These medications help patients overcome the withdrawal symptoms that occur when they stop taking the substance they are addicted to. They also aid in reducing cravings for the substance, making it easier for patients to complete their treatment. The administration of medication during addiction treatment is closely monitored and controlled by health professionals, ensuring that patients receive safe and effective treatment.Asides from medication, alternative therapies are also used in National City to complement addiction treatment. These therapies include the use of acupuncture, yoga, and meditation. Acupuncture helps to reduce anxiety and relieve physical pain, while yoga and meditation help to soothe the mind, relieve stress, and curb cravings.In conclusion, addiction treatment in National City is centered around the care and well-being of the patient. With a range of treatment modalities available, from inpatient to outpatient services, patients can choose the best option to help with their recovery. Addiction treatment centers in National City offer programs that are tailored to individual needs, and the use of medication, along with alternative therapies, adds depth to the treatment provided. Though addiction is a complex issue, National City is committed to helping individuals overcome it in every way possible.
